Client upgraded from v4.3 to v4.4 last week. Fairly smooth migration. However, they are noticing that SOME balances per the Turnover report do not tie to the balances per the Inventory valuation report. The inventory valuation report has the correct numbers.
How does one fix this? Recalculate Item History? Where is the inventory turnover report pull its numbers from?

If you are talking about the Quantity On Hand YTD, it is calculated based on the ‘Year’ and ‘Period/Month’ selected and uses the following: IM_PeriodPostingHistory: BeginningBalQty + PeriodChangeQty

Tried that but it throws a somewhat cryptic error
"A record with an invalid posting date was encountered in an item transaction table. The recalculation cannot continue."
I rebuilt the key files for inventory and common items. Rebuilt the sort files for inventory. I downloaded the IM_Transaction history records into Excel and scanned for bad transaction date (none noted).
Any thoughts on what the real issue is? No error number, program name or line # provided.

The program not only reads the IM_ItemTransactionHistory table, but also the following tables when it's processing:
IM_PeriodPostingHistory
IM_ItemCustomerHistoryByPeriod
IM_ItemVendorHistoryByPeriod
IM_ItemWhseHistoryByPeriod
CI_ItemTransactionHistory
CI_ItemHistoryByPeriod
The only table from the list above that has a 'Posting Date' is CI_ItemTransactionHistory. The rest all have Year and Period/Month fields so I don't think it's one of them because of the message you're receiving.
Try doing the same thing that you did on the Item Transaction table to the CI_ItemTransactionHistory and see if the corrupted date is in there.

There's another date field in those tables called 'Reference Date' which may be the 'Posting Date' the program is referring to. If you do another search on that field with no results, then contacting support sounds like your next step.
